Prayer for the Peace of Jerusalem.

A Song of Ascents, of David.

122 I was glad when they said to me,
“Let’s (A)go to the house of the Lord.”
Our feet are standing
Within your (B)gates, Jerusalem,
Jerusalem, that has been (C)built
As a city that is (D)firmly joined together;
To which the tribes (E)go up, the tribes of [a]the Lord
[b]An ordinance for Israel—
To give thanks to the name of the Lord.
For (F)thrones were set there for judgment,
The thrones of the house of David.

Pray for the (G)peace of Jerusalem:
“May they prosper who (H)love you.
May peace be within your (I)walls,
And prosperity within your (J)palaces.”
For the sake of my (K)brothers and my friends,
I will now say, “(L)May peace be within you.”
For the sake of the house of the Lord our God,
I will (M)seek your good.

A Davidic Song of Ascents

Up to Jerusalem

122 I rejoiced when they kept on asking me,
    “Let us go to the Lord’s Temple.”
Our feet are standing
    inside your gates, Jerusalem.
Jerusalem stands built up,
    a city knitted together.
To it the tribes ascend—
    the tribes of the Lord
as decreed to Israel,
    to give thanks to the name of the Lord.
For thrones are established there for judgment,
    thrones of the house of David.

Pray for peace for Jerusalem:
    “May those who love you be at peace![a]
May peace be within your ramparts,
    and[b] prosperity[c] within your fortresses.”

For the sake of my relatives and friends
    I will now say, “May there be peace within you.”
For the sake of the Temple of the Lord our God,
    I will seek your welfare.
